The Future of CAD: Innovation and Advancements

The Computer-Aided Design sector is poised for a period of unprecedented expansion. With rapid advancements in artificial intelligence deep learning, cloud computing, and technology, CAD software is becoming increasingly sophisticated. This will enable designers to create more complex and innovative models with greater speed.

One of the most exciting developments in CAD is the rise of generative design. This technology uses algorithms to automatically generate multiple design solutions based on specific parameters. This can save designers effort and lead to more creative and efficient designs.

Furthermore, the increasing integration of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) into CAD workflows is transforming the design process. VR allows designers to visualize 3D models in a realistic setting, while AR can be used to overlay digital models onto the real world.
